Solution Overview
Problem
Conventional item listing systems lack comprehensive brand-focused artificial intelligence functionality, including machine learning model training, security administration, and listing management tools, leading to challenges in verifying brand authenticity, detecting counterfeits, and maintaining user trust and compliance.
Innovation Solution
Implement a brand-focused artificial intelligence system comprising a machine learning model training engine, security administrator engine, and listing management engine, trained on a multi-dimensional authenticity analysis dataset, to predict and enforce brand information, enhance detection of counterfeits, and improve listing quality.

Methods, systems, and computer storage media for providing brand-focused listing management in an item listing system are described. Using a brand-focused machine learning model, the brand-focused listing management engine supports listing accuracy compliance with the item listing marketplace standards, and optimization of search visibility and customer experience. The brand-focused listing management engine also supports identifying deliberate bypassing or violating of the item listing system's guidelines for product listings and employs corrective actions to improve listing quality and functionality associated with listing management including seller listing flow and optimizing visibility based on listing quality signals. In operation, an item listing associated with an item listing system is accessed. The listing is analyzed using a brand-focused machine learning model that is trained based on a multi-dimensional authenticity analysis dataset. Based on analyzing the item listing, a brand-focused security notification associated with the item listing is generated. The brand-focused security notification is communicated.
